Orient Spring Bass

;)Generally speaking, the Springtime at Orient is the best chance you have for catching fish in great numbers. During the last 15 years, I've organized trips on charterboats during that time and have rarely been disappointed. Keeper-size-wise, the fish will usually range from 28 - 34 in. with largest being maybe 36 in. However, there are always exceptions on any given day. During that time of year, almost all of the action is in the daytime, with bucktails and diamond jigs accounting for most or all of the action. If you can't get a spot on Capt.
